Discover Garland, Maine
Garland, Maine is a rural community in Penobscot County, set amid rolling fields and forestland northwest of Bangor and near the service centers of Dexter and Dover-Foxcroft. The town sits within easy reach of Sebasticook and Piscataquis lake regions, with scenic drives connecting Garland to Moosehead Lake country to the north. Garland offers a quiet, small-town setting while remaining close to U.S. Route 15 and other regional corridors.
Home to roughly 1,000 residents across about 40 square miles, Garland has a low-density, countryside feel. The town’s modest village area features a classic New England church, historic buildings, and a handful of local services, farm stands, and home-based enterprises rather than a dense Main Street of shops and restaurants. Nearby Dexter and Dover-Foxcroft provide additional dining, shopping, and cultural options, complementing Garland’s peaceful pace.
Outdoor recreation defines life in Garland, Maine, with access to local ponds for paddling and fishing, snowmobile and ATV trails, and miles of quiet roads for walking and biking. Golfers can find courses in neighboring towns, and hikers enjoy regional trail networks like Peaks-Kenny State Park on Sebec Lake. Community events often center on seasonal suppers, town-wide yard sales, and agricultural fairs in surrounding communities, reflecting a friendly, close-knit vibe grounded in tradition, open space, and year-round recreation.
